The Athletic Demands of Bull Riding

Bull riding requires immense physical strength and explosive power to withstand the violent, unpredictable movements of a bucking animal. Riders must maintain a rigid core and leg stability while absorbing tremendous G-forces, often compared to being in a car crash. The extreme athletic demands also include superior balance, grip endurance, and mental fortitude to stay focused for the required eight seconds. This dangerous sport subjects the body to severe impacts and whiplash, making exceptional conditioning and resilience non-negotiable for any competitor.
